Problems related to boats and streams are different in the computation of relative speed from those of trains/cars. .

When a boat is moving in the same direction as the water current/stream, the boat is said to be moving WITH THE STREAM OR CURRENT. .

When a boat is moving in a direction opposite to that of the water current/stream, it is said to be moving AGAINST THE STREAM OR CURRENT. .

SPEED OF THE BOAT IN STILL WATER is the speed of the boat when it travels in water that is not moving. .

When the boat is moving upstream, the speed of the water opposes (and hence reduces) the speed of the boat. .

When the boat is moving downstream, the speed of the water aids (and thus adds to) the speed of the boat. Thus, we have .

Speed of the boat against stream = Speed of the boat in still water - Speed of the stream. .

Speed of the boat with the stream = Speed of the boat in still water + Speed of the stream. .

These two speeds, the speed of the boat against the stream and the speed of the boat with the stream, are RELATIVE SPEEDS. .

In problems, instead of a boat, it may be any other moving body, the approach is exactly the same. .

Circular Tracks

When two people are running around a circular track starting at the same time from the same point, we would be interested in finding out the time taken by them to meet for the first time anywhere on the track or to meet for the first time at the starting point. .

This can be done when the two people are running in the same direction or in the opposite direction. .

Similarly, we can find the time taken for THREE people to meet each other to meet for the first time anywhere on the track or at the starting point. .

Let the length of the circular track be L. Let three people be A, B and C run around the circular track with speeds of a, b and c respectively where a > b > c. They start running from the same point at the same time.

Also, when two people are running around a circular track starting from the same point at the same time, then every time the two people meet, the faster person covers one full round more than the slower person and vice-versa. .

Example.2

In a 1000 m race, A beats B by 100 m and C by 180 m. In a 1800 m race, by how many meters does B beat C? .

Solution

By the time A covers 1000 m, B covers 1000 - 100 = 900 m and C covers 1000 - 180 = 820 m. .

By the time, B covers 1800 m, the distance C covers = x 820 = 1640

So, B beats C by 1800 - 1640 = 160 m. .

example.3

A man can swim at 6 kmph downstream and 4 kmph upstream. Find the speed of the man in still water and also the speed of the stream. .

Solution

Let the speed of the man in still water be x kmph and speed of the stream be y kmph

x + y = 6 ------- (1) x - y = 4 ----------- (2)

Solving the equations we get x = 5 and y = 1
